poner en funcionamiento
to put into operation
* * *
(v.) = activate, set in + action, set up, trip, put into + working order, put in + place, put in + place, put into + place, set in + motion
Ex. Deferred orders are activated when the 'claim overdue order' function is run.
Ex. So he sets a reproducer in action, photographs the whole trail out, and passes it to his friend for insertion in his own memex.
Ex. This means that it must be well documented, with for example user manuals, test data and guidance on setting up systems.
Ex. The cord which trips its shutter may reach down a man's sleeve within easy reach of his fingers.
Ex. One of the definitions of 'organise' is to give orderly structure to, put into working order.
Ex. Compromise organization schemes, making allowances for weaknesses of individuals, will naturally be put in place as necessary.
Ex. Compromise organization schemes, making allowances for weaknesses of individuals, will naturally be put in place as necessary.
Ex. Garvey suggests that the list of references is a key part of any scientific paper, since they help to put the research described into its proper place in the development of the scientific consensus.
Ex. If someone reports that a member of the staff is drunk while on the job, the supervisor must immediately set in motion the prescribed personnel procedures for verifying the charge, issuing a warning, observing and documenting future performance, and, if necessary, initiating a dismissal action.
